1 April 1999Skeletonization algorithm based on cross segment analysis
A new thinning algorithm for binary images is presented. The algorithm is based on the analysis of crossing segments that are constructed by an almost perpendicular approach to the direction of the line. In the appropriate area, similar crossing segments or similar boundaries as well as special connecting points are located. The experimental results carried out on handwritten characters show the efficacy of the algorithm with respect to other methods.
